Vastness of the world demonstrated in new walkthrough with game designers Shigeru Miyamoto and Eiji Aonuma.
Game designers Shigeru Miyamoto and Eiji Aonuma walked through some of the new game's key elements, including its visuals and large game world. Players can pinpoint locations on the map using the Wii U GamePad, too, which in turn creates an in-game beacon to aid navigation.
The video also shows off the gliding Sailcloth and revealed a new intelligent Epona who is now able to avoid trees and obstacles without guidance from the player, making horseback combat possible.
The Legend of Zelda for Wii U will launch at some point in 2015.
